Output 89a260a9773962390511e4969b87a3c183c84b1a39d6fb09e6435a253a188e49:0

value
170936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c851d2b0e8bc70cd3ca5852b79e32aa7f1cc23d OP_EQUAL
address
3LLREbWJLRhbCfUaneYbFa5SE7vi8QR8Va
transaction
89a260a9773962390511e4969b87a3c183c84b1a39d6fb09e6435a253a188e49
spent
false

14 Sat Ranges